Read storyUsing Scheduled Shutdowns to Optimize Amazon ECS Development Costs
Keeping Amazon ECS development & testing environments workloads running when they're not actively used can lead to considerable expenses for teams.Implementing scheduled shutdowns of Amazon ECS cloud resources when not in use can lead to cloud cost savings with relatively little implementation effort.Four ways to achieve shutdowns for Amazon ECS include (1) manual shutdowns, (2) Lambda functions, (3) Cloudwatch templates and (4) schedules inside a platform such as Sedai.

Read storyWhat is an Autonomous System?
Now, how does an automated system differ from an autonomous system?. If Tesla were to provide alerts for every left and right turn and you, as the driver, make those turns based on the alerts, that would be an automated system. In this case, the responsibility is shifted to the driver rather than relying solely on the machines.
